Stockholm Ferries

  • Find Stockholm ferries

    Book simply and easily with AFerry

  • Safe and secure booking

    Feel confident booking with "The World's Leading Ferry Website"

  • Stockholm ferries from AFerry

    Find information on Stockholm ferries

  • Millions of satisfied customers

    We're the biggest ferry website in the world and we have a dedicated call centre, just in case

Looking for a cheap Stockholm ferry? You came to the right place!

Book Stockholm ferries right here on AFerry.com. View the latest special offers, and find timetables for all ferries to and from Stockholm. Alternatively, use the booking form on the left to select a date and route that suits you to find a price. At AFerry.com we work with more ferry companies than anyone else, giving us the most complete range of routes available online.

Below are the best prices our customers have found over the last 3 days. If you see a price you like, hit the Go button!

  • Turku - Stockholm

    • 1 x Foot Passenger(s) Return
      Travel: 09/08/2015 - 10/08/2015
    • from: £88
    • Tallink Silja
    • passenger(s)
  • Turku - Stockholm

    • Car + 2 Return
      Travel: 01/07/2015 - 02/07/2015
    • from: £73
    • Tallink Silja
    • passenger(s)
  • Helsinki - Stockholm

    • Car + 4 Return
      Travel: 19/05/2015 - 21/05/2015
    • from: £205
    • Tallink Silja
    • passenger(s)

Stockholm Ferry Times & Sailing Information

  • Helsinki - Stockholm (Tallink Silja)

    • Timetable
    • up to 7 crossings per week
    • 16hrs 30mins
    • Tallink Silja
  • Mariehamn - Stockholm (Tallink Silja)

    • Timetable
    • up to 3 crossings per day
    • from 4hrs 30mins
    • Tallink Silja
  • Riga - Stockholm (Tallink Silja)

  • Stockholm - Helsinki (Tallink Silja)

    • Timetable
    • up to 7 crossings per week
    • 17hrs 10mins
    • Tallink Silja
  • Stockholm - Mariehamn (Tallink Silja)

    • Timetable
    • up to 3 crossings per day
    • from 6hrs 25mins
    • Tallink Silja
  • Stockholm - Riga (Tallink Silja)

  • Stockholm - Turku (Tallink Silja)

    • Timetable
    • up to 2 crossings per day
    • from 11hrs 30mins
    • Tallink Silja
  • Stockholm - Tallinn (Tallink Silja)

    • Timetable
    • up to 7 crossings per week
    • 16hrs 30mins
    • Tallink Silja
  • Turku - Stockholm (Tallink Silja)

    • Timetable
    • up to 2 crossings per day
    • from 9hrs 55mins
    • Tallink Silja
  • Tallinn - Stockholm (Tallink Silja)

    • Timetable
    • up to 7 crossings per week
    • 16hrs 15mins
    • Tallink Silja

Booking your Stockholm ferry

Booking a cheap Stockholm ferry could not be easier at AFerry.com. Simply select your route and number of passengers from the booking form on the left hand side to get started.

You can also compare similar routes, using our "Compare Prices" tab. Select the route and dates you would like to travel on to view the cheapest sailings and their alternatives in an easy to view list.

On this page you will also find a port map, with the port address below so that you know where to go on the day.

At AFerry.com we work hard to make sure you get the best possible deal for your Stockholm ferry. Whether you book a ferry to Stockholm or a similar alternative, you can be confident in finding our best prices.

Sign-up & Save

Get our newsletter and never miss a ferry deal!

Follow us on

Facebook
Twitter
Google Plus
RSS
YouTube
ERROR GENERATING PANEL DATA [port_addressess_no_icon Message:Input string was not in a correct format. Stack trace: at System.Number.StringToNumber(String str, NumberStyles options, NumberBuffer& number, NumberFormatInfo info, Boolean parseDecimal) at System.Number.ParseDecimal(String value, NumberStyles options, NumberFormatInfo numfmt) at CallSite.Target(Closure , CallSite , Type , Object , CultureInfo ) at Helpers.ReflectionHelper.SetProperty(PropertyInfo property, Object objectToPopulate, Object value) at Helpers.SqlHelper.GetMultipleTypedRows[T](String connectionString, String sql, SqlParameter[] params) at ContentServer.Models.ContentData.GetPortAddresses(ContentPage contentPage, Boolean requireAddress) at ContentServer.PanelViewModels.ContentPanel_PortAddresses..ctor(ContentPage contentPage) at ContentServer.Code.ContentPanelFactory.CreatePanel(String panelName, Dictionary`2 attributes, ContentPage cp)]